Iran's Foreign Ministry has clarified that no talks are scheduled with the United States in Islamabad. Foreign Minister Abbas Araghchi is in Pakistan to discuss regional peace. He will meet with Pakistani officials. Iran's views will be conveyed to Pakistan. This visit follows US plans for envoys to engage in talks linked to Tehran.
